Duty calls for Skem striker

By David Watters

Skelmersdale United

Skelmersdale United hot-shot Josh Hine is quitting the Evo-Stik NPL First Division North title challengers to join the Royal Air Force.

The striker’s eight goals so far this season have helped manager Tommy Lawson scoop two Manager of the Month awards already and the club admit their top scorer will be missed at the West Lancashire College Stadium.

The former Southport, Burscough and Vauxhall Motors frontman signed for Skem in January from Clitheroe before quickly establishing himself in Lawson’s team and helping to fire them into contention this season.

A club spokesman left the door open to Hine returning one day, duty permitting. "He will be sadly missed by everyone at Skem but has been told he will always be welcome back whenever he can make it," he said.
